UPVC Repairs Near Me

uPVC is the abbreviation for Unplasticised Polyvinyl Chloride, is a low-maintenance construction material that has replaced stained timber windows in many homes. uPVC is invulnerable to rot, mould and corrosion, making it ideal for frames, doors, sills and doors.

uPVC repairs performed by experts can bring back the home's functionality energy efficiency, as well as security. This could involve realigning or replacing parts and lubricating mechanisms.

Window sill repair

Although window sills aren't the most visible part of a window, they play a significant role in a home's appearance. They are also very exposed to weather, so they can be easily damaged. There are many ways to repair window sills. The first step is to assess the damage. Check for cracks or splits that extend beyond the surface. Wood glue can be used to fill small gaps but larger gaps will need to be fixed. It is a good idea to look for large chunks of concrete are missing.

This usually means that there is a bigger problem that needs more extensive repairs or replacing. If the cracks are more extensive and large pieces are missing, you may want to replace the entire window sill.

Before you start it's best to make sure you have the proper tools for the job. To remove the old sill, you'll need an utility knife, putty knives mallet or hammer the pry-bar, and a chisel. It is best to be careful to avoid damaging the frame of the window.

After you've removed the old sill, it's crucial to remove any rot or mold that might have formed around the frame. If you don't eliminate it, it could continue to grow. This could result in more damage. You can use a paint scraper to remove any caulk or paint that's been damaged due to decay.

You should then paint the window sill. Fill in any gaps left by using window repairs near me spray foam for an encapsulated seal. Then, you can use a sander to smooth out the surface of the sill.

Wood is the most common material used for window sills. However, there are also sills made of stone and tile. Wooden sills can be painted or stained to ensure they are more resistant to the elements. Stone and tile sills, on the other hand are more durable and do not require special care. It's important to maintain your windowsills to prevent damage from water and other issues.

Window frame repair

The frames, sills and windows' sashes are essential components of a house. They keep the glass in place and offer insulation, however they can also be damaged or worn out over time. These issues can cause mould, draughts and other problems and must be fixed as soon as possible.

The first step to window frame repair is to examine the frames and sills to see if they are damaged. Find evidence of rot or moisture. If you find any, it's recommended to seek out a professional to fix the issue as soon as you can. The longer you wait, the worse it'll get.

Moisture around window frames as well as in walls can cause decay. This is not only unsightly, but it is also a health risk for people suffering from asthma and respiratory conditions. Moisture may also cause leaks that are difficult to spot. This could be due to the leak occurring in a different area of the home or caused by faulty window frames.

If the frames are made of wood it is an ideal idea to get them stained or painted frequently. This can help them resist the elements and extend their life. It is also essential to check for damage regularly and replace hardware as necessary. If you notice that the windows are stuck or have difficulties opening and closing it's time to contact a professional.

Over the years, most wooden windows will require some maintenance. This could include fixing cracks or splits. They are also affected by the elements, specifically heat and sun. Wood is prone to insect damage and rot, so it's best to repair or replace it as soon as you notice any damage.

Repairing wooden window frames is costly, but it's usually cheaper than replacing them. The cost of a repair job is dependent on the extent of the damage and the materials used. A wooden window repair typically costs between $175 to $300 for a window. Repairs to aluminum frames are less expensive, however they are still susceptible to damage over the years. Temperature changes can cause them to crack or bend, and this could lead to the loss of the sealant needed to weatherproof.

French door repair

French doors are a stunning addition to any home. They offer a wide view to the outdoors and let in plenty of sunlight. Like any window or doors, they are susceptible to deterioration due to weather conditions and wear and tear. It is crucial to address these issues as soon as you can. They can range from minor issues to major issues. Fortunately, repairs are easy and cost-effective.

The most common problem with french doors is that they don't close properly. This can be due to a variety of causes such as poor installation or an incorrect alignment. To address the issue, just close the door and look for any obstructions which could be preventing it from closing. Close the door again and re-align it to make sure it works properly.

Another common problem with french doors is that the latch can get stuck. This is a problem that can be frustrating because it can hinder doors from opening and closed. You can fix this problem by re-lubricating the lock or replacing the latch. However, if you are not confident working on your French doors, it is recommended to speak with an expert for assistance.

Finally, French doors may be damaged by decay or moisture. This occurs when the wood's finish begins to deteriorate and allows moisture into the pores. This causes the wood to expand and contract, resulting in the wood rotting. Untreated, the rot will spread to other parts of the wood. This type of damage doesn't have to be fatal. Resin glue can be used to fix the damage.
